Oxegen Nearly Here!

Monday, July 2nd, 2007

Oxegen is nearly upon us, and the organisers are letting people know about some of the stuff that will be available other than music.

The thing that caught my eye was Campsite Karaoke. I'm a big fan of Karaoke, and Campsite Karaoke sounds like a great idea! Er... as long as it's not too near your tent when you're trying to go to sleep that is...

It's apparently provided by Coca Cola, who also provide another genius idea: ClashFinder. No, not a hunt for the late great Joe Strummer, but a way to organise your timetable of who you want to see, and even get text alerts when your favourite bands are due on stage.

Apparently Ambre Solaire will also be at hand to protect you from the blazing sunshine everybody's hoping for, and there will also be a service providing lockers to keep valuables in. Why you'd bring valuables to a festival I don't know, but there you go!
